The Filk Hall of Fame activities are the signature events at FilKONtario, including the banquet, formal induction of new members, and Hall of Fame concert. This year will be the 17th Annual Hall of Fame Induction.

The Jury for the Filk Hall of Fame (representing all the filk cons in US, Canada, UK and Germany) will decide who will be inducted each year, based on your nominations. Their decision is final. Three new members of the Filk Hall of Fame are usually inducted each year. The new members will be introduced at the banquet, and honoured in song at the Hall of Fame concert on Sunday.

Banquet

Our Hall of Fame Banquet is a buffet dinner catered by the hotel. We think it's pretty good.Photo: banquet

If you indicate that a vegetarian option is needed, we're happy to oblige. Note that we cannot guarantee this option AT the con, but we will try to do so. Price is Cdn TBA in advance, more at the door. This is our cost; we don't make any money on the banquet, and Concom members pay for their own dinner. Don't forget - the price we charge you includes taxes and tip, so it works out to a fairly reasonable cost for a great meal, and the joy of seeing friends inducted into the Filk Hall of Fame!

One-Shots

Suburban TravestyA one-shot is a chance for you to get up on the stage and sing one song. Just one. Many of us start out that way (your esteemed webmistress did!) and it is a worthwhile experience.

There are usually 12-15 one shots held during the concerts Saturday afternoon. A sign-up sheet will be available at registration from Friday evening. Some overflow may be available, but not guaranteed.
